In the first week of October, using the SGS #258208 TVC-TRF05 HT8: Famo MFU and the Multiplex Smart SX9 Flexx transmitter and receiver that come with it, I had
all the FAMO functions working. I had tested and tested each function at every step of assembly. So with great care, I mounted the MFU on a platform between the frame rails, tucked the receiver in away from the MFU, and did some "wire management" with wire ties. I was ready to put the 4 ohm speaker in its place behind the grill and the battery at the back of the engine bay. In fine. Then I went to Scotland for two weeks.
Now that I'm back, none of the FAMO functions works.

I checked the battery voltage, continuity of connections, etc., etc., etc. Suspecting that the Multiplex transmitter was no longer binding to the Multiplex receiver that came with it, I tried re-binding them. Nothing doing! Not even a light on the receiver.
For comparison, I dug out my little "Jeep" that I had set up last winter with the Flysky FS-i6X transmitter and FX-i6. It ran when parked, but nothing doing now! So I re-bound the Flysky transmitter and the receiver in the Jeep and
all works fine. Apparently, a transmitter and receiver can come unbound just sitting with no batteries in either and no other use in the intervening time.
